Шаблон процесса согласования договора

1. aleks xantaev 8 27.07.17 06:13 Сейчас в теме
Документооборот 8 КОРП, редакция 1.4 (1.4.13.1)
Есть разные шаблоны процессов, в которых указаны разные руководители отделов. Но согласно структуры предприятия отделы входят в различные департаменты, в итоге какую настройку необходимо сделать что бы в шаблоне процесса согласования возможно было указывать именно руководителей которые указаны в головных ветках структуры предприятия.

Департамент автослужбы(рукводитель ИвановИ)->отдел авторемонтная мастерская(руководитель(ПетровП) в отдел входит сотрудник СидоровС

СидоровС создает процесс и первым согласующем в процессе должен быть именно ИвановИ.
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. reshkra 27.07.17 06:39 Сейчас в теме
Заполняете структуру предприятия в соответствии с вашими департаментами и отделами,
В шаблоне указываете "Все руководители автора процесса". Только порядок будет начинаться с непосредственного руководителя, а потом уже вышестоящий.
3. aleks xantaev 8 27.07.17 07:02 Сейчас в теме
(2) Мне нужен только вышестоящий руководитель
5. vlad636 4 28.08.17 05:26 Сейчас в теме
(3) Еще есть автоподстановка - "Непосредственный руководитель автора документа".
6. aleks xantaev 8 28.08.17 08:14 Сейчас в теме
(5)Не совсем то что надо, мне необходим головной руководитель всего подразделения. Этот вопрос уже решил, добавил свой элемент автоподстановки
4. YRN 15 22.08.17 09:08 Сейчас в теме
Можно в шаблоне указать автоподстановку "Все руководители автора процесса" и добавить "Использовать условия", если не получится, создавайте свою "автоподстановку".

Функция ПолучитьСписокДоступныхФункций(ИменаПредметовДляФункций = Неопределено, ВключатьНедоступные = Истина) Экспорт
	
	ДоступныеФункции = ШаблоныБизнесПроцессовПереопределяемый.ПолучитьСписокДоступныхФункций(
		ИменаПредметовДляФункций);
	
	ДоступныеФункции.Добавить("ШаблоныБизнесПроцессов.АвторБизнесПроцесса(Объект)", 							 НСтр("ru = 'Автор процесса'"));
	ДоступныеФункции.Добавить("ШаблоныБизнесПроцессов.НепосредственныйРуководительАвтораБизнесПроцесса(Объект)", НСтр("ru = 'Непосредственный руководитель автора процесса'"));
	ДоступныеФункции.Добавить("ШаблоныБизнесПроцессов.ВсеРуководителиАвтораБизнесПроцесса(Объект)", 			 НСтр("ru = 'Все руководители автора процесса'"));
	ДоступныеФункции.Добавить("ШаблоныБизнесПроцессов.ВсеПодчиненныеАвтораБизнесПроцесса(Объект)", 				 НСтр("ru = 'Все подчиненные автора процесса'"));
	ДоступныеФункции.Добавить("ШаблоныБизнесПроцессов.ВсеКоллегиАвтораБизнесПроцесса(Объект)", 				 	 НСтр("ru = 'Все коллеги автора процесса'"));
...................................
	
	Возврат ДоступныеФункции;
	
КонецФункции
 
Показать
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от